General Description
(Z)-6-(3-Carboxyacrylamido)hexanoic acid is a specialized chemical compound with a specific structure, as suggested by its name. This includes a hexanoic acid component which consists of a six-carbon chain that terminates in a carboxylic acid group (-COOH). Additionally, it has a carboxyacrylamido group, which typically consists of a double bond between the carbon and nitrogen atoms. The prefix '(Z)-' refers to the configuration of the molecule in terms of the position of certain atoms or groups, following the internationally recognized Cahn-Ingold-Prelog priority rules; in this case, signifying that the highest priority groups are on the same side of the double bond. This organic compound can have potential applications in various fields, including synthetic chemistry and materials science.
